WebYou are permitted to give small, tax-free, cash gifts up to the value of £250 (for example, as a Christmas or birthday gift). However, you cannot give small gifts to the same people or person you have gifted your annual exemption to. If given to the same people or person, there will be tax implications for these gifts. WebThe gift of a lifetime Chorus That's what You gave The gift of a lifetime Your life as an offering That's what You gave My life to save Your life as an offering Turning my song of tears My life to save To an anthem of praise … Web8 Feb 2024 · A lifetime gift can also be challenged due to the donor being subjected to undue influence to make the gift. Undue influence may be ‘actual’ or ‘presumed’. Actual undue influence arises where there are acts of improper pressure or coercion which override a person’s volition to make their own decisions.

Release Calendar Top 250 Movies Most Popular Movies Browse … english to tamil translation wordsWeb21 Feb 2024 · The exemptions which only apply to gifts made during lifetime are: The annual exemption. You can gift up to £3,000 every year, free from IHT. If you do not use your exemption in one tax year, you can bring it forward to the next tax year so that a potential £6,000 allowance is available in the following tax year.
